Electrician ArticlesGet A Home Electrical Inspection From A ElectricianIf you are thinking about moving and want to do things right, you should have a licensed electrician check out the home for electrical problems before you think about buying. You will get a idea of any electrical problems and even estimates and what it would cost to have them fixed. When we go out house shopping we don't often think about hiring someone to come out and inspect a home for us before we purchase it. But it is highly recommended and will help to save you money in the long run. It is good advice to hire a home inspector for a general home inspection and a licensed electrician to go out and look over the home and check it for any defects or problems. These people are skilled to check out the home and find any problems that may cause you trouble after you purchase it.
